Comments: Ranges south to Rio de la Plata (Ref. 31268). Found in San Jorge Gulf, 5°40' southwards from its known distribution. Collected at Solano Bay (45°43' S, 67°21' W) near Comodoro Rivadavia, Chubut Province (Ref. 86990).

Elasmobranchii (tubarões e raias) (sharks and rays) > Rajiformes (Skates and rays) > Arhynchobatidae (Softnose skates)
Etymology: Sympterygia: Greek, syn, symphysis = grown together + Greek, pteryx = fin (Ref. 45335).

Environment: milieu / climate zone / depth range / distribution range Ecologia

marinhas demersal; intervalo de profundidade 10 - 188 m (Ref. 57911).   Subtropical; 20°S - 40°S, 60°W - 40°W (Ref. 57911)

Distribuição Países | Áreas FAO | Ecossistemas | Ocorrências | Point map | Introduções | Faunafri

Southwest Atlantic: Rio de Janeiro, Brazil to Rio de la Plata, Argentina.

Tamanho / Peso / Idade

Maturity: Lm ?  range ? - ? cm
Max length : 150 cm TL macho/indeterminado; (Ref. 57911); common length : 36.0 cm WD macho/indeterminado; (Ref. 26408)

Biologia     Glossário (ex. epibenthic)

Oviparous (Ref. 50449). Eggs have horn-like projections on the shell (Ref. 205).

Life cycle and mating behavior Maturities | Reprodução | Spawnings | Egg(s) | Fecundities | Larvas

Oviparous, paired eggs are laid. Embryos feed solely on yolk (Ref. 50449).

Estimates based on models

Preferred temperature (Ref. 115969): 11.3 - 21.8, mean 19.5 (based on 65 cells).
Phylogenetic diversity index (Ref. 82804):  PD50 = 0.5625   [Uniqueness, from 0.5 = low to 2.0 = high].
Bayesian length-weight: a=0.00407 (0.00265 - 0.00627), b=3.02 (2.89 - 3.15), in cm Total Length, based on LWR estimates for this species & (Sub)family-body (Ref. 93245).
Nível Trófico (Ref. 69278):  3.7   ±0.55 se; based on food items.
Resiliência (Ref. 120179):  Baixo, tempo mínimo de duplicação da população 4,5 - 14 anos (Assuming fecundity<100).
Fishing Vulnerability (Ref. 59153):  Very high vulnerability (90 of 100).
